Kinds Of Influencers in China



Influencer marketing in China incorporates a diverse variety of influencer types, each with distinct qualities, audience demographics, and content focuses. A primary distinction exists in between micro-influencers and macro-influencers. Micro-influencers have smaller, highly engaged audiences, frequently concentrating on specific niche markets and leveraging platforms like Douyin and Xiaohongshu to promote products to their devoted followers.


Alternatively, macro-influencers boast bigger followings and frequently serve as brand ambassadors, partnering with prominent brand names to showcase products to their substantial audiences.


Lifestyle influencers and charm influencers are 2 significant categories, with many content developers achieving substantial success on social platforms such as Weibo and WeChat. These influencers frequently focus on particular locations, consisting of fashion, travel, and cosmetics, allowing them to construct credibility and trust with their audiences.


Subsequently, they are extremely looked for after by brand names aiming to take advantage of China's vibrant and huge consumer market. China's Influencer Marketing Regulations



China's regulative framework for influencer marketing consists of a complex network of laws, regulations, and guidelines that influencers, firms, and brand names need to adhere to to avoid possible risks.


Staying notified about regulative updates and comprehending compliance difficulties are important for successful influencer marketing in China.


Key policies governing influencer marketing in China include:



  1. Cybersecurity Law: Controls online material and information storage, impacting influencer marketing projects that involve data collection and online promos.




  1. Advertising Law: Establishes standards for advertising material, consisting of restrictions on deceptive or incorrect claims, and requirements for clear labeling of advertisements.




  1. E-commerce Law: Controls online commerce, consisting of influencer marketing projects that involve item sales or promos.



Increased enforcement of these policies by Chinese authorities has actually resulted in fines and charges for non-compliant influencers, agencies, and brand names.


To lessen compliance threats, working together with knowledgeable influencer companies and legal experts familiar with China's regulative landscape is vital.

What Commission Rates Do Influencer Agencies in China Usually Charge?



Influencer firm commission rates in China show significant variability, generally subject to negotiation based on project scope, influencer tier, client budget plan, and agency knowledge.


Basic charge structures cover 10% to 30% of total project expenditure, with some agencies opting for flat fees or inflating influencer rates to make sure profitability.
